As a part of Special Wednesdays, Angat Pangat was planned on 2nd July 2025. Children brought a variety of dishes made from sprouts in their tiffin boxes. Instead of having lunch in the classrooms, they were enjoying the lunch in the open environment by sitting in a pangat. This initiative embossed the traditional way of having food by sitting on the ground and be thankful to God for blessing with the things we have. They also sat in Vajrasan position after the lunch for good digestion of food.
